About C. Baines
C. Baines is a scholar working on Condensed Matter Physics, Electronic, Optical and Magnetic Materials, Materials Chemistry, Atomic and Molecular Physics, and Optics and Spectroscopy, having authored 174 papers that have together received 5.2k indexed citations. Recurring topics across this work include Physics of Superconductivity and Magnetism (92 papers), Advanced Condensed Matter Physics (84 papers), Rare-earth and actinide compounds (66 papers), Iron-based superconductors research (54 papers), Magnetic and transport properties of perovskites and related materials (25 papers), Magnetism in coordination complexes (23 papers), Multiferroics and related materials (20 papers) and Organic and Molecular Conductors Research (16 papers). The work is most often cited by research in Condensed Matter Physics (4.4k citations), Electronic, Optical and Magnetic Materials (3.5k citations), Atomic and Molecular Physics, and Optics (977 citations), Accounting (291 citations) and Materials Chemistry (975 citations). C. Baines has collaborated with scholars based in Switzerland, United Kingdom and France. Frequent co-authors include A. Amato, H. Luetkens, R. Khasanov, F. L. Pratt, P. Mendels, F. Bert, A. Yaouanc, P. Dalmas de Réotier, Stephen J. Blundell and Peter J. Baker. Their work appears in journals such as Physical Review B, Physical Review Letters, Physical review. B., Physica B Condensed Matter and Physical review. B, Condensed matter.
